I am a licensed, nationally certified counselor with over six years of experience counseling underserved adolescents and young adults in an urban environment. I am trauma-informed, culturally competent, strengths-based counselor who is passionate about empowering people to discover and utilize their own unique gifts and strengths. I prioritize building relationships, which allows me to really know my clients and show up for them in the ways they need.
The first session is all about getting to know each other to ensure we are a good fit. I want to know what motivated you to seek therapy, your goals for the time we work together, and some background information. It is also a chance for you to decide if you feel comfortable with me, with my approach, and if you think we will be a good fit.
Authenticity, curiosity, and fidelity are the qualities that allow me to build strong therapeutic connections. To best serve you, I constantly evaluate my approach and interventions to ensure they are congruent with your strengths and goals, and that you are being appropriately challenged in a way that feels safe and supportive. I utilize a variety of modalities, including CBT, REBT, and DBT to identify distorted thoughts and explore the relationship between beliefs and behaviors. Elements of solution-focused and Gestalt therapies are also used, when appropriate. Above all, I am a strengths-based counselor and want to see you tap into the potential you already possess.
My passion is figuring out the "whys" of life. If you are interested in understanding yourself better to make positive change, I’d love to work with you. I will focus on helping you reach your goals by recognizing unhealthy patterns, identifying root causes, and building skills that allow you to move forward. We will also work on healthy and effective communication, so the progress made in sessions can be utilized in all areas of your life; whether that means advocating for yourself at work, strengthening your relationships, improving your inner dialogue, or anything in between. My experience and background have positioned me to work especially well with people struggling with ADHD, depression, anxiety, and family/relationship issues.
Treatment methods and interventions must always be tailored to the individual, but everyone has strengths. The starting point is identifying the client's strengths--from there, I work with the client to create a treatment plan that utilizes those strengths to meet an identified goal.
